Output e4efc3402c80ea301f6da492d30d299e1620c8cdf5c6917a1fe9cbda9f48b839:3

value
999124
script pubkey
OP_0 OP_PUSHBYTES_20 161787855c4a96c93de793e222269ebc51dfc613
address
bc1qzctc0p2uf2tvj008j03zyf57h3gal3snxu8x5m
transaction
e4efc3402c80ea301f6da492d30d299e1620c8cdf5c6917a1fe9cbda9f48b839
confirmations
228697
spent
true